About this cruise

Somewhere around day five the ship stops being transport and starts being home. This 14-night sailing from Miami on March 12, 2028 visits Celebration Key, Puerto Plata (Amber Cove) and San Juan, with additional stops along the Caribbean. The ports come early and the voyage wraps with sea days. A good way to decompress before heading home. The Caribbean route takes in Bahamas, Dominican Republic, Puerto Rico, Turks & Caicos Islands, U.S. Virgin Islands and Sint Maarten, 6 countries, and the differences show up in the food, the architecture, and the mood. Most ports give you about 8 hours, so you can do more than just tick off the main sights. As for the ship itself, Regal Princess keeps you well fed. 12 places to eat, with 6 included in the fare and a few specialty spots if you're in the mood. 14 nights is long enough to build a routine on board: favourite restaurant, favourite deck chair, favourite people. It starts to feel like a floating village. If you like having options (restaurants, bars, activities, entertainment), a big ship delivers that. A spring departure helps too: decent weather and a calmer feel at each port. Hard to ask for much more than that, honestly.

What's included in this price

In this price
Everything a cruise fare covers

Your cabin with daily housekeeping, every meal on board, and the shows, pools and gym. 6 of this ship's 12 restaurants cost extra if you want them.

On top of this price
Tips

Billed on board by default. You can adjust it at guest services.

Also available to buy on board: Alcohol, Soft drinks, Wi-Fi, Excursions.
